Uncommon Noises



If you're listening to weird and unknown noises coming from your home heating and air system, it is necessary to address them quickly to avoid more damage or possible breakdown. Unusual sounds can show underlying issues with your system that need prompt attention.

One usual noise is a loud banging or clanging noise, which might suggest there's a problem with the blower motor or a loosened part within the system. A shrill screeching or screeching noise might suggest a worn-out belt or malfunctioning motor bearings. Rattling or shaking sounds could be caused by loose ductwork or a loose follower blade.

Overlooking these sounds can cause extra severe problems and higher repair work expenses down the line. So, if you're listening to any type of uncommon sounds, it's best to call an expert a/c professional to diagnose and fix the problem immediately.

Inconsistent Temperatures



Experiencing inconsistent temperature levels in your home? If you find yourself continuously changing the thermostat to maintain a comfortable temperature level, it may be an indication that you require to replace your home heating and air system.

Irregular temperatures can be caused by a range of concerns, such as a malfunctioning thermostat, ductwork troubles, or an aging HVAC system. These temperature fluctuations can cause pain and higher energy bills as your system functions harder to make up for the inconsistencies.

Furthermore, irregular temperatures can show that your system is no more able to uniformly distribute air throughout your home, resulting in cold and hot spots.

Increasing Energy Costs



Sick of constantly paying out cash for repairs? Well, prepare yourself to tackle another economic challenge: rising power prices with your home heating and air system.

As time passes, your heating and cooling system might become less reliable, resulting in enhanced power consumption and greater energy bills. If you notice a constant rise in your energy prices in spite of no changes in your use routines, maybe an indicator that your heating and air system is no longer running efficiently.

Older systems often tend to shed their power performance with time, creating them to work more difficult and take in more power to maintain the preferred temperature. By changing your outdated system with a more recent, much more energy-efficient version, you can dramatically reduce your power expenses and conserve money in the long run.
